How much does it cost to install solar panels in Bartlett?

Per a survey we carried out in October 2023, the typical cost of installing solar panels across the country is $11,743.

The price of solar panel installation is influenced by several factors, such as where you live, sunlight exposure, roof alignment, shading, system size and labor. Be prepared to pay more if you choose add-ons like batteries, solar trackers or animal guards.

According to data from NASA, the EIA and the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), installing solar panels in Bartlett generally runs about $19,280.

How much can you save by going solar in Bartlett?

Solar panel installation is a substantial initial investment, but you can expect to see major savings reflected in your energy bills after some time.

Money savings in Bartlett from going solar

In Bartlett, you can expect to save money once you've fully switched to solar. But it takes time to make back the upfront costs, and factors like precipitation and tree coverage impact how soon you'll get a return on your solar investment.

  • Payback period: The average payback period is the time it takes for a solar energy system to recover its initial cost. The payback period in Bartlett is around 21 years, according to our calculations, which are based on data from the Database of State Incentives for Renewables and Efficiency (DSIRE), NASA and the EIA.
  • Annual solar savings in Bartlett: Based on calculations that leverage data from the EIA, the Department of Energy and NASA, Bartlett homeowners save around $912 per year with solar energy.
  • Average total solar savings after 25 years: Over 25 years, you can potentially save $9,400 after transitioning fully to solar, according to our calculations based on data from NASA and the U.S. Energy Information Administration.

What solar incentives are available in Bartlett?

Several solar incentives are available to Bartlett homeowners. Some programs are open to all Tennessee residents, though others change by municipality, utility company and city.

Accessible solar incentives to Tennessee homeowners, as stated by DSIRE, include:

Name / Incentive TypeIncentive Amount/Details
Property Tax Incentive
Green Energy Property Tax Assessment
Depends upon sector
Personal Tax Credit
Federal Residential Renewable Energy Tax Credit
30% federal tax credit for systems placed in service after 12/31/2021 and before 01/01/2033. Good for: solar water heat, solar photovoltaics, biomass, geothermal heat pumps, wind (small), fuel cells using renewable fuels.

What are common factors to consider before hiring a Bartlett solar installer?

When selecting a solar panel installation professional, first review these key considerations.

What size system do you need?

Your household's energy use and the solar system's production ratio dictate the appropriate panel system size for you. Larger residences tend to use more power and will potentially need more extensive solar setups. An undersized system faces the risk of inadequate energy generation to fully power your home.

Is your home subject to specific permits and regulations?

Your solar installation project could be subject to the necessary codes and permit requirements by your state. You'll need to obtain the required permits from your local building department, as well as schedule an inspection.

Does your home get enough sunlight access?

Not all homes have the same amount of sun. Nearby trees, precipitation and extreme weather can affect sunlight access. If your property doesn’t get adequate sunlight, then you may need more panels with higher wattage.

Do you need a solar battery?

For extra power storage, many panel systems feature a solar battery. This feature is essential in cloudy conditions and helps to mitigate power loss. However, opting for battery storage can result in higher overall installation expenses.

Which type of solar panel do you want?

There are several solar panel types available, with differences in life expectancy, design and efficiency. These aspects impact not just the cost, but also how often panels will need to be replaced and the space needed on your roof.
